Surpac Vision   Surpac Vision is the flag ship product of Surpac.  Surpac Vision is a comprehensive software

                        system for ore body evaluation, open pit and underground mine design, mine planning and

                        production. It is the most widely used system of its kind in the world, with clients across 85 countries.

Quarry              Quarry is a modern software product designed for the cement, aggregate and other industrial

                        minerals mining and quarrying industry. It contains powerful tools for quarry design, planning

                        and production in a format which is easy to apply for fast accurate information.

Xplorpac           Xplorpac is an exploration product for the management, interpretation and modeling of exploration drillholes.

                        It includes digitizing geology and ore outlines and wire framing those shapes within a consistent 3D

                        working environment. It also includes professional drill hole plotting and a wide range of additional tools

                        that are essential to exploration geologists.

MineSched       MineSched is a scheduling application which is both practical and powerful, for surface and

                        underground mining. It incorporates a 3D approach to setting up the mine schedule, and proving

                        to have tremendous advantages over traditional spreadsheet techniques in both efficiency for

                        routine scheduling projects, and is tremendously powerful for complex projects.

Sirovision          Sirovision is a significant new high precision 3D photogrammetry and 3D digital imaging technology

                        for mapping of rock and terrain surfaces for geology and surveying. The Sirovision photogrammetric

                        tools deliver an unprecedented level of surface detail to be modeled from digital photographs taken from

                        a distance of up to 700 meters. Sirovision is a 3D digital image technology and has significant implications

                        for mine safety, where detailed information can be collected without staff positioning themselves in high

                        risk situations. The collection and analysis of photogrammetry 3D and digital imaging 3d data is also far

                        more cost effective than traditional 'manual' methods of data collection.
